幸福路人

文章
5
资源
0
加入时间
3年0月8天

第86页的gtk+编程例子——菜单与工具栏的组合

以下gtk+编程例子是来自书籍《实用技术:开发Linux应用——用GTK+和GDK开发Linux图形用户界面应用》第86页的内容——菜单与工具栏的组合这是几页纸的内容综合应用,也是将之前所学的知识和所写的小程序组合在一起,就是一个应用程序窗口,既要有菜单文字和工具图标,同时有鼠标点击功能,快捷键功能,和鼠标停留在图标会出现文字提示工具条按钮的鼠标点击动作由activate变为clicked才能起作用,为工具条按钮加入文字提示,当鼠标停留在图标就会出现文字提示,它的函数是gtk_tool_item

巨杉数据库 mysql_整体框架_SequoiaDB简介_文档中心_SequoiaDB巨杉数据库

整体框架SequoiaDB 巨杉数据库作为分布式数据库,由数据库存储引擎与数据库实例两大模块构成。其中,数据库存储引擎模块是数据存储的核心,负责提供整个数据库的读写服务、数据的高可用与容灾、ACID与分布式事务等全部核心数据服务能力。数据库实例模块则作为协议与语法的适配层,用户可根据需要创建包括 MySQL、MariaDB、PostgreSQL 与 SparkSQL 在内的结构化数据实例;支持 J...

1、动态数组(array)

1、数组(array vs list)array: 定长,操作有限,但是节省内存,可以用import array直接导入list: 会预先分配内存,操作丰富,但是耗费内存。list.append: 如果之前没有分配够内存,会重新开辟新区域,然后复制之前的数据,复杂度退化list.insert: 会移动被插入区域后所有元素,O(n)list.pop: pop不同位置需要的复杂度不同pop...